Virtual Reality as an Educational Tool
Virtual reality technology is considered one of the most exciting developments in the field of education. This technology allows students to enter immersive educational environments, enabling them to experience complex scientific concepts or explore historical sites without leaving the classroom. For example, students can study planets through virtual journeys across the galaxy, where they can see the intricate details of celestial bodies. These virtual experiences enhance deep understanding and promote retention and engagement.

The Effect of Play-Based Education on Early Learning
Play-based educational strategies occupy an important position in early education, playing a significant role in developing children’s foundational skills. Play-based activities help children explore their world and stimulate their senses through hands-on experiences. Through play, children can learn fundamental concepts such as counting, colors, and shapes indirectly, making learning enjoyable and engaging. This type of learning helps children build social skills and learn how to collaborate with peers, essential skills for their future lives.

Ideas on Implementing Play-Based Learning in Classrooms
Ideas related to implementing play-based learning can include a variety of activities. For example, cooperative games that solve problems can be used, where students face challenges that require them to work together and share knowledge. Simulation games can also be implemented, allowing students to experience certain scenarios within an educational context, helping them to understand concepts more deeply and interactively. Additionally, critical thinking can be enhanced through games that require students to make strategic decisions based on multiple pieces of information.

International Experiences in Technological Integration
Globally, there are several successful experiences in integrating technology into education. Countries that have effectively implemented digital learning strategies have seen marked improvements in academic achievement, such as Finland, which relies on project-based learning and inclusive education. Other experiences in countries like Singapore and Japan highlight how technology can be used to enhance interactive learning and develop 21st-century skills. These experiences underscore the importance of adopting best global practices and adapting them to local contexts that meet the needs of different communities.
